Naomh Conaill show no mercy

-

NAOMH CONAILL began their defence of the Donegal SFC title with a 23-point hammering (3-20 to 0-6) of Milford.

Naomh Conaill showed no mercy after blasting into a 1-3 to 0-0 lead after just four minutes. Dermot Molloy, Charles McGuinness and Eunan Doherty hit the goals in their one-sided victory.

Kilcar soared to a 4-21 to 0-7 win over Termon. Donegal stars Ryan McHugh and Patrick McBrearty were to the fore, while Conor Doherty and Stephen McBrearty scored 1-3 each.

Gaoth Dobhair eased to a 2-17 to 0-7 win over Four Masters with former Donegal players Kevin Cassidy and Odhrán Mac Niallais scoring the goals.

Niall O’Donnell kicked three points as St Eunan’s recorded a 0-15 to 1-5 win over Bundoran, while Gerard Ward’s eight points helped Glenfin defeat Killybegs by 1-12 to 1-6.

An injury to Michael Langan was a black mark in St Michael’s 3-5 to 0-8 win over Michael Murphy’s Glenswilly. Langan netted a goal after just 10 seconds, while Murphy saw a penalty saved by Oisín Cannon.
